What is the best approach to make a Wig Wag light for Prepar3D v3 scenery?
The FSX method and P3Dv2 method does not work as light effects.

I used tweaked FS2004 code in the past but this does not work any longer in P3D v2 and v3. So I realized my current wigwags with a simple animation. This works for FSX, P3Dv2 and P3Dv3 without any problems.
Try the appended MDL-File, the necessary texture files are also included. You can see how it looks like in the video of the wigwags placed in my EDFM- Mannheim scenery.
